Diesel Technology Forum: 57% of all commercial diesel trucks on the roads in US are near-zero emissions models

Green Car Congress

According to DTF’s analysis of S&P Global Mobility TIPNet Vehicles in Operation Data as of December 2022: Diesel dominates the trucking sector: For the largest commercial trucks (Class 8) in operation that are 2010 or later model years, 95.4% For the entire (Class 3-8) commercial truck population of more than 15 million vehicles, 75.6%

Latest generation diesels power 36% of US commercial trucks

Green Car Congress

Thirty-six percent of all commercial diesel trucks on US roads are now powered by the newest generation of diesel technologies (MY 2011 and newer), up from 30% in 2016 and 25.7% Meanwhile, Florida, California and New Hampshire have the fastest-growing heavy duty clean diesel fleets (% change, 2016-2017: FL 81%; CA 37%; NH 35%).

South Florida Communities Purchase 11 Hydraulic Hybrid Refuse Trucks with Parker Hannifin System

Green Car Congress

The Florida communities of Hialeah, Miami-Dade County, and the City of Miami are purchasing 11 Autocar E3 refuse trucks fitted with parker Hannifin’s RunWise hydraulic hybrid technology. During a full month of testing in South Florida, the RunWise system registered a 72% improvement in fuel efficiency. Earlier post.)
